The recipe is super simple: bake a box mix of fudge brownies-let cool and cut into bite size squares. Make pudding-again using large box of chocolate pudding and mix with 2cups cold milk (put in fridge to set up). Chop up twix into small pieces or whatever candy your heart desires. Thaw a container of whipped topping.


put an even layer of brownie pieces first, then 1/2 of pudding, a layer of whip cream and then candy. Repeat one more time. YUM! Pretty much Heather and I snacked on this all weekend long until it was polished off !
